Our Lightweight Samue Jacket is a stylish jacket that will last a lifetime. Samue (or Samu-e or Samu-gi) is traditionally the work jacket for a Buddhist monk or nun in Japan. And it looks great on anyone. Wear it to the meditation hall, the dojo, around town or working in the garden. We tailor these black jackets from comfortable 6.5 oz cotton twill. The samue closes with ties and you’ll find it has a zippered outside pocket and a hidden inside pocket. Our samue is pre-shrunk, so it’s machine washable.
